Infineon Accelerates $5 Billion Bet to Defend Chip Crown

16.04.2026 - 16:05:00 | boerse-global.de

Infineon speeds up its largest-ever $5B chip fab investment as a Japanese rival alliance forms. The firm retains its top spot in automotive chips and targets AI data center growth.

The Munich-based semiconductor giant is bringing forward the launch of its new Smart Power Fab in Dresden. With a total project volume of approximately €5 billion, this facility represents the single largest investment in Infineon's history. Management has increased its capital expenditure plan for the full year from €2.2 billion to €2.7 billion, with the Dresden plant consuming the lion's share. The factory's ramp-up has been accelerated, with doors now set to open this summer to drastically boost output for in-demand automotive chips.

This aggressive expansion comes as a formidable Japanese alliance takes shape. Competitors Rohm, Toshiba, and Mitsubishi Electric are exploring a merger of their power semiconductor divisions. A combined entity would command roughly 10% of the global market, positioning it directly behind Infineon, which currently holds about 17% in this specific segment. The Asian group is particularly focused on challenging Infineon's position in coveted silicon carbide chips.

Infineon's robust market position provides a solid foundation for this countermove. Recent data from TechInsights confirms the company retained its title as the world's leading automotive semiconductor supplier for a sixth consecutive year. While its overall market share in the $74.4 billion sector dipped slightly to 12.8%, its lead over the nearest rival actually widened. The company's dominance is most pronounced in the high-margin niche of automotive microcontrollers, where it boosted its global share by 3.9 percentage points to a commanding 36.0%. This leadership has been reinforced in both Europe and China, the world's most critical single market.

These chips serve as the central nervous system for software-defined and electric vehicles, a reliability underscored by their recent use in NASA's successful Artemis II mission. Beyond automotive, Infineon is capitalizing on the artificial intelligence boom, though not by building AI processors. Instead, it supplies the essential power semiconductors that ensure stable electricity for high-performance AI data center servers. The company forecasts revenue from this segment will reach €1.5 billion by 2026, climbing to €2.5 billion the following year.

Operational performance remains strong. First-quarter revenue for 2026 came in at €3.66 billion, with analysts anticipating around €3.8 billion for the current second quarter. A significant additional lever is pricing power; price increases effective from April were not factored into the company's previous outlook, potentially boosting future margins.
